The Basics of Connecting Spotify to Apple Watch

To get started, you need to ensure you have the necessary apps and settings in place. Follow these steps to connect Spotify to your Apple Watch:

  1. Install Spotify on Your iPhone: The first step is to have the Spotify app installed on your iPhone. If you haven’t done this yet, head to the App Store, search for Spotify, and install the app.

  2. Update Your Devices: Make sure that both your iPhone and Apple Watch have the latest operating systems. This ensures compatibility and can prevent any connectivity issues.

  3. Install Spotify on Apple Watch: You can find the Spotify app on your Apple Watch through the App Store on your iPhone. Simply search for Spotify in the Watch App and install it.

  4. Log In to Your Spotify Account: Open the Spotify app on your Apple Watch and log in using your existing Spotify account.

  5. Connect Your Devices: Once installed, your Apple Watch should automatically connect to the Spotify app on your iPhone via Bluetooth. Make sure Bluetooth is enabled on both devices.

By following these simple steps, you can have Spotify up and running on your Apple Watch in no time!

Key Features of Spotify on Apple Watch

Using Spotify on your Apple Watch offers several interesting features that enhance your music experience:

  • Control Playback: You can play, pause, skip, or rewind tracks without needing to access your phone. This ease of control is particularly useful during workouts or while on the go.
  • Offline Playback: Spotify Premium users can download playlists, albums, and podcasts directly to their Apple Watch and listen without an Internet connection.

Potential Challenges with Spotify on Apple Watch

While Spotify connects to Apple Watch seamlessly, there can be some challenges or limitations users may encounter.

1. Limited Features

While controlling playback is a key feature, not all features available on the mobile or desktop version of Spotify are present on the Apple Watch. For instance, complex playlist management or music discovery features might be limited. You won’t be able to sort through your music library in-depth like on a phone or computer.

2. Battery Usage

Streaming music directly from your Apple Watch can lead to battery drain, especially if you do not have a downloaded playlist and are using cellular data or Wi-Fi for streaming. Users will need to pay attention to their battery levels and manage their settings accordingly.

3. App Performance

Some users have reported issues with app lagging or delays when navigating through playlists on their Apple Watches. These can typically be resolved by ensuring that both the Apple Watch and iPhone have the latest updates installed.

How to Optimize Your Spotify Experience on Apple Watch

To get the most out of your Spotify experience on your Apple Watch, consider these useful tips:

1. Download Playlists for Offline Use

As mentioned, Spotify Premium users can download playlists to their devices. To download your favorite playlist:

  • Open the Spotify app on your Apple Watch.
  • Navigate to the playlist you want to download.
  • Select the ‘Download’ option.

This way, you can listen without worrying about mobile data or Wi-Fi restrictions.

2. Utilize Siri for Voice Commands

Siri integration allows you to control Spotify hands-free. Simply raise your wrist and say, “Hey Siri, play my workout playlist on Spotify” or “Skip this song,” making it even easier to navigate while you’re on the move.

3. Customize Notifications

Spotify can send you notifications for new music releases, concert alerts, and more. However, you might want to customize these in the Apple Watch settings to ensure you don’t get overwhelmed with notifications while enjoying your music.

Is the Spotify app on Apple Watch free to use?

The Spotify app on Apple Watch is free to download, but to unlock its full potential, a Spotify Premium subscription is required. With a Premium account, you can take advantage of offline listening, ad-free streaming, and the ability to play any song on demand. This makes it a worthwhile investment for those who regularly use Spotify for their music needs.

Without a Premium account, users have limited functionality, mainly being able to control playback of songs that are playing on their phone. Therefore, to get the most out of the Spotify experience on your Apple Watch, it is recommended to subscribe to Spotify Premium.

What should I do if Spotify isn’t working on my Apple Watch?

If Spotify isn’t working on your Apple Watch, the first step is to check your internet connection. Although the app can work offline, it requires a stable connection to download content initially and to update any playlists. Make sure your Apple Watch is connected to Wi-Fi or your iPhone before troubleshooting further.

If the connection is good and the problem persists, try restarting both your Apple Watch and iPhone. Additionally, ensure that the Spotify app is updated to the latest version. If issues continue, uninstalling and reinstalling the app may resolve any glitches, allowing Spotify to work smoothly on your device.
